Abstract
Disclosed is a porous membrane comprising (1) a hydrophilic copolymer X composed principally of (poly)alkylene glycol mono(meth)acrylate units A and ethylene units B and (2) a polyolefin Y, the (poly)alkylene glycol mono(meth)acrylate units A being of the formula ##STR1## where R.sup.1 and R.sup.2 independently represent hydrogen or methyl, and n has a value in the range of 1 to 9. This porous membrane has permanent hydrophilicy suitable for the treatment of water-based liquids and can be produced by an industrially advantageous process. This process comprises melt-forming a blend of (1) a hydrophilic copolymer X composed principally of (poly)alkylene glycol mono(meth)acrylate units A and ethylene units B and (2) a polyolefin Y; heat-treating the melt-formed product in a vacuum or an inert gas medium at a temperature not higher than the melting point of polyolefin Y for a period of an hour or more; and stretching the heat-treated, melt-formed product to make it porous.
